Property investments in Romania reach €567 million in H1

by Property Forum
Investments in Romania’s commercial real estate market amounted to €566.9 million in the first half of this year, compared to €194 million in the same period of last year, according to a report by real estate consultancy FortimTrusted Advisors, an alliance member of BNP Paribas Real Estate.

Home prices in Romania almost flat in June

by Property Forum
Asking prices of apartments in Romania fell by 0.3% in June compared to the previous month, with the average listing price of a property reaching €1,745 per sqm.
